Output 161deda68f2c74ae6773315fee43d5115873d39b684fa94e557c6eff51ca6e25:3

value
269519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ddf964bfb8b79dc14b7606d4e4d2cbd40e7e40 OP_EQUAL
address
3QUC6M5AE59rcwfgqopL4wUkYzQPc9Mawy
transaction
161deda68f2c74ae6773315fee43d5115873d39b684fa94e557c6eff51ca6e25
spent
true